Untitled is a 2006 by Mona Hatoum, held at Museum of Modern Art.
This sketch shows a rough outline of the world’s continents on a blank page. The lines are faint, almost erased, with no clear borders between land and water. It looks like someone traced a map but left it unfinished. The simplicity makes it feel more like a thought experiment than a detailed drawing.
